一种航班信息的推荐方法、系统、存储介质和电子设备技术方案

技术编号:30283898 阅读:22 留言:0更新日期:2021-10-09 21:54
本发明专利技术涉及航空信息技术技术领域,提供一种航班信息的推荐方法、系统、存储介质和电子设备,所述方法包括:根据预设社交网络数据,构建无向图,从所述无向图中得到至少一个完全图;向任一完全图中每个节点对应的用户的智能终端推荐相同的航班信息,基于预设社交网络数据构建能够表示多名用户之间的社交关系的无向图,从无向图中得到的至少一个完全图,完全图中的每两个节点对应两名用户之间均存在社交关系,说明完全图对应的所有用户之间联系紧密,此时向完全图对应的每名用户的智能终端推荐相同的航班信息,无需再针对每名用户建立相应的数据模型,降低了数据处理的复杂度。降低了数据处理的复杂度。降低了数据处理的复杂度。

【技术实现步骤摘要】
一种航班信息的推荐方法、系统、存储介质和电子设备


[0001]本专利技术涉及航空信息技术
,尤其涉及一种航班信息的推荐方法、系统、存储介质和电子设备。

技术介绍

[0002]随着我国从航空运输大国到航空运输强国战略的逐渐展开,航班信息的数据量与日俱增,目前,航空公司会根据用户的出行习惯,为每名用户提供对应的航班信息,以减少用户为获取航班信息所花费的时间,但是,这样需要分析每名用户的习惯并建立每名用户的数据模型,然后根据每名用户的数据模型获取对应的航班信息并向用户进行推荐,导致数据处理过程异常复杂以及效率低的问题。

技术实现思路

[0003]本专利技术提供一种航班信息的推荐方法、系统、存储介质和电子设备,旨在解决的技术问题是:如何高效地推荐航班信息。
[0004]本专利技术的一种航班信息的推荐方法的技术方案如下:
[0005]根据预设社交网络数据,构建无向图,其中,所述无向图中的节点表示:所述预设社交网络数据涉及的用户,所述无向图中的任意两个节点之间的边表示:该两个节点所对应的两名用户之间存在社交关系;
[0006]从所述无向图中得到至少一个完全图;
[0007]向任一完全图中每个节点对应的用户的智能终端推荐相同的航班信息。
[0008]本专利技术的一种航班信息的推荐方法的有益效果如下:
[0009]基于预设社交网络数据构建能够表示多名用户之间的社交关系的无向图,从无向图中得到的至少一个完全图,完全图中的每两个节点对应两名用户之间均存在社交关系,说明完全图对应的所有用户之间联系紧密,此时向完全图对应的每名用户的智能终端推荐相同的航班信息,无需再针对每名用户建立相应的数据模型,降低了数据处理的复杂度,因此,本申请的一种航班信息的推荐方法能过高效地进行航班信息的推荐。
[0010]在上述方案的基础上,本专利技术的一种航班信息的推荐方法还可以做如下改进。
[0011]进一步,所述向任一完全图中每个节点对应的用户的智能终端推荐相同的航班信息,包括:
[0012]生成任一完全图中的每个节点所对应的短链接,且所有短链接均指向待推荐的航班信息;
[0013]将每个短链接发送至相应用户的智能终端;
[0014]当任一用户点击接收到的短链接时,转向所述待推荐的航班信息。
[0015]采用上述进一步方案的有益效果是:向用户的智能终端发送短链接,相比于待推荐的航班信息,短链接的长度更短,能够减少存储空间,便于管理。
[0016]进一步,还包括:
[0017]当任一用户未查看接收到的短链接的时长超过预设时长、且已生成新的待推荐的航班信息时,将该用户接收到的短链接指向所述新的待推荐的航班信息。
[0018]采用上述进一步方案的有益效果是:若采用现有技术中,无论用户是否已经查看接收到的航班信息,每次更新待推荐的航班信息后,都会将更新后的待推荐的航班信息发送至用户的智能终端,容易引起客户的反感,降低用户体验度,本申请中,当任一用户未查看接收到的短链接的时长超过预设时长、且已生成新的待推荐的航班信息时,并不需要重新发送短链接,只需要将该用户接收到的短链接指向新的待推荐的航班信息,当用户点击短链接时,即可获取新的待推荐的航班信息,既能保证用户能得到最新的航班信息以进行购买机票等操作,还降低了推荐频率,极大提高用户体验度。
[0019]进一步,还包括:
[0020]统计并根据任一完全图对应的每名用户的生活轨迹信息,得到该完全图对应的每名用户的常用活动区域;
[0021]获取所有常用活动区域中出现次数大于预设次数的公共区域,将与公共区域关联的机场的机场信息确定为待推荐的航班信息。
[0022]采用上述进一步方案的有益效果是:将任一完全图对应的公共区域的关联的机场的机场信息确定为待推荐的航班信息,能够尽量保证推荐的准确度。
[0023]本专利技术的一种航班信息的推荐系统的技术方案如下:
[0024]包括构建模块、获取模块和推荐模块;
[0025]所述构建模块用于根据预设社交网络数据,构建无向图,其中,所述无向图中的节点表示:所述预设社交网络数据涉及的用户,所述无向图中的任意两个节点之间的边表示:该两个节点所对应的两名用户之间存在社交关系;
[0026]所述获取模块用于从所述无向图中得到至少一个完全图;
[0027]所述推荐模块用于向任一完全图中每个节点对应的用户的智能终端推荐相同的航班信息。
[0028]本专利技术的一种航班信息的推荐系统的有益效果如下:
[0029]基于预设社交网络数据构建能够表示多名用户之间的社交关系的无向图,从无向图中得到的至少一个完全图,完全图中的每两个节点对应两名用户之间均存在社交关系,说明完全图对应的所有用户之间联系紧密,此时向完全图对应的每名用户的智能终端推荐相同的航班信息,无需再针对每名用户建立相应的数据模型,降低了数据处理的复杂度,因此,本申请的一种航班信息的推荐系统能过高效地进行航班信息的推荐。
[0030]在上述方案的基础上,本专利技术的一种航班信息的推荐系统还可以做如下改进。
[0031]进一步,所述推荐模块具体用于:
[0032]生成任一完全图中的每个节点所对应的短链接,且所有短链接均指向待推荐的航班信息;
[0033]将每个短链接发送至相应用户的智能终端;
[0034]当任一用户点击接收到的短链接时,转向所述待推荐的航班信息。
[0035]采用上述进一步方案的有益效果是:向用户的智能终端发送短链接,相比于待推荐的航班信息,短链接的长度更短,能够减少存储空间,便于管理。
[0036]进一步,所述推荐模块还用于:当任一用户未查看接收到的短链接的时长超过预
设时长、且已生成新的待推荐的航班信息时,将该用户接收到的短链接指向所述新的待推荐的航班信息。
[0037]采用上述进一步方案的有益效果是:若采用现有技术中,无论用户是否已经查看接收到的航班信息,每次更新待推荐的航班信息后,都会将更新后的待推荐的航班信息发送至用户的智能终端,容易引起客户的反感,降低用户体验度,本申请中,当任一用户未查看接收到的短链接的时长超过预设时长、且已生成新的待推荐的航班信息时,并不需要重新发送短链接,只需要将该用户接收到的短链接指向新的待推荐的航班信息,当用户点击短链接时,即可获取新的待推荐的航班信息,既能保证用户能得到最新的航班信息以进行购买机票等操作,还降低了推荐频率,极大提高用户体验度。
[0038]进一步,还包括确定模块,所述确定模块用于:
[0039]统计并根据任一完全图对应的每名用户的生活轨迹信息,得到该完全图对应的每名用户的常用活动区域;
[0040]获取所有常用活动区域中出现次数大于预设次数的公共区域,将与公共区域关联的机场的机场信息确定为待推荐的航班信息。
[0041]采用上述进一步方案的有益效果是:将任一完全图对应的公共区域的关联的机场的机场信息确定为待推荐的航本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种航班信息的推荐方法,其特征在于,包括:根据预设社交网络数据,构建无向图,其中,所述无向图中的节点表示:所述预设社交网络数据涉及的用户,所述无向图中的任意两个节点之间的边表示:该两个节点所对应的两名用户之间存在社交关系;从所述无向图中得到至少一个完全图;向任一完全图中每个节点对应的用户的智能终端推荐相同的航班信息。2.根据权利要求1所述的一种航班信息的推荐方法,其特征在于,所述向任一完全图中每个节点对应的用户的智能终端推荐相同的航班信息,包括:生成任一完全图中的每个节点所对应的短链接,且所有短链接均指向待推荐的航班信息;将每个短链接发送至相应用户的智能终端;当任一用户点击接收到的短链接时,转向所述待推荐的航班信息。3.根据权利要求2所述的一种航班信息的推荐方法,其特征在于,还包括:当任一用户未查看接收到的短链接的时长超过预设时长、且已生成新的待推荐的航班信息时,将该用户接收到的短链接指向所述新的待推荐的航班信息。4.根据权利要求1至3任一项所述的一种航班信息的推荐方法,其特征在于,还包括:统计并根据任一完全图对应的每名用户的生活轨迹信息,得到该完全图对应的每名用户的常用活动区域;获取所有常用活动区域中出现次数大于预设次数的公共区域,将与公共区域关联的机场的机场信息确定为待推荐的航班信息。5.一种航班信息的推荐系统,其特征在于,包括构建模块、获取模块和推荐模块;所述构建模块用于根据预设社交网络数据,构建无向图,其中,所述无向图中的节点表示:所述预设社交网络数据...

【专利技术属性】
技术研发人员:刘志全许红才原凯
申请(专利权)人:海南太美航空股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1